Transaction 98499dda62c1103679d281c9eb589e61f87e4a0088992b2a4411133bd5c4373f
1 Input
2 Outputs
- 98499dda62c1103679d281c9eb589e61f87e4a0088992b2a4411133bd5c4373f:0
- 98499dda62c1103679d281c9eb589e61f87e4a0088992b2a4411133bd5c4373f:1
value 1501650000
address 39F2FfRzZ8uRUEraJFXAnnmHodQtHRFYNr
value 19609828540
address 1Es1aLpUASoPkH3EMfDZdbmzFd8mXaAkBw